EASYPAL / EASYDEPAL
2-axis Cartesian palletizer by layers
2-axis Cartesian palletizer/depalletizer with combined chain and roller table, with box gripping system using a clamp equipped with 2 or 4 jaws, designed for palletizing or depalletizing boxes in layers.

| Reference product | Boxes of any size compatible with the pallet |
| Palletizing pattern | Any configuration |
| Maximum load | Up to 175 kg. |
|
Connectivity
|
Industry 4.0 Ready |
| Production rate | Up to 3 layers per minute. |
Equipped | with rotator device for label orientation. |
Efficiency:
- Low consumption, IEE (Intelligent Energy Efficiency).
- The motorized elements remain on stand-by mode until they need to move and after a certaing period of zero activity they stop.
Features:
- Simple and intuitive creation of mosaics by the operator using proprietary software.
- Reversed layer function to improve stability.
Safety and ergonomy:
- Study and treatment of safety and ergonomics from the start of the design process, machine subjected to risk analysis and auditable risk assessment.
- Touchscreen interface with various levels of accessibility, allowing you to adjust all parameters that influence the machine's performance. (pallet patterns, Timers, Speeds, Counters, etc.)
Durability:
- Machine manufactured from steel processed by laser cutting, water jet cutting, bending, electro-welding, and precision parts made in machining centers.
- Structures and thicknesses optimized using specialized software calculations.
- Combined finishes in two-component polyurethane, epoxy paint, galvanized and/or stainless steel.
- Labeling machine integration.
- Automatic pallet dispenser and changer.
- Reversed layer function to improve stability.
- Pallet addition between layers function. (Manual or automatic).
- KTS, remote assistance.
- Full stainless version available

WEIGHTSENT DW5E
Dynamic checkweigher up to 5 kg
Automatic dynamic weight checker, specially designed for small bags and boxes. It includes diverter for rejection.

| Reference product | Any product weighing between 50 g and 5 kg. |
| Production rate |
Up to 120 units/minute. |
| Resolution | +- 1 g. |
|
Accuracy |
+- 5 g. |
Efficiency:
- Low consumption, IEE (Intelligent Energy Efficiency).
- The motorized elements remain on stand-by mode until they need to move and after a certaing period of zero activity they stop.
Handling:
- Compact machine that can be easily integrated into the production line
Regulations:
- Capacity to work in food grade environments.
- Batch control.
- Statistics
- LAN connectivity.
- Integrations: SCADA, ERP.
